Table 1.
Various metallic fillers use for fire retardant applications [69].
Flame Retardant Chemical Nature |
Example of Flame Retardants | Working Mechanism |
---|---|---|
Metal oxides and hydroxide | Magnesium hydroxide, Aluminum hydroxide, alumina trihydrate, calcium carbonate | Heat sink |
Boron based | Boric acid, borax, Zink borate, boron phosphate | By forming the insulating layer |
Halogen based | TCPA, TBPA, Polybrominated diphenyl ethers, Polybrominated biphenyl | Gas-phase |
Phosphorus based | THPC | Condense phase |
Synergistic | P/N, Halogen/Antimony tri-oxide, P/halogen | The presence of other compounds would increase the slowness of the flame emitted by the major compound. |
Intumescent | Acid donor (ex-phosphoric acid, ammonium polyphosphate), carbonizing agent (ex-pentaerythritol), bowling agent (ex-melamine, urea) | Both in the gas and condensed phase |
